Old-fashioned, home furnishings, lighting & accessories showcased in the Noble Hardee Mansion.
IF THE WALLS OF THE Noble Hardee Mansion could talk, they’d have to speak up to be heard over the hoard of antiques jostling for attention in their rooms.
Billing itself as the “last unrestored grand mansion of Savannah,” this decaying southern gem lives up to its own hype: peeling paint, crumbling plaster, and genteel neglect. Currently an antique store, it is a mecca for those who love old stuff, enjoy decrepitude-induced shivers, or any combination thereof.
Commenced in 1860 by the man who shares its name, the Noble Hardee Mansion looks down and out on Monterey Square. Completed in 1869, it claims the distinction of visits from genial — and utterly forgettable — US President Chester A. Arthur.
